Salmon and asparagus wraps

Prep: 5 mins
Cook: 10 mins
Salmon and asparagus wraps
These wraps are delicious, fast to make and super healthy.
 

2 tsp olive oil

1 small red onion, sliced

100g asparagus spears, cut into 3cm pieces

4 large tortilla wraps

200g fresh smoked salmon

2 tbsp fresh dill

Add the oil to a pan, then the onion and asparagus.

Cook for 4 minutes, stirring regularly.

Warm the wraps together in a dry, non-stick frying pan over a low heat for 2-3 mins.

Alternate, so each gets time directly on the heat transferring them to a plate as you go.

Add the salmon (in slices) to the onion and asparagus and mix gently for 2 minutes to warm through.

Add a tablespoon of water, cover and remove from the heat.

Put ¼ of the mix and ¼ of the dill into each tortilla.

Roll up, cut in half and serve with a garnish of dill.
